The monoamine oxidase inhibition properties of indazole derivatives
The monoamine oxidase (MAO) enzymes are important catalysts of the metabolism of biogenic and dietary amines in the central and peripheral nervous systems.

1-Chloro-3-(6-nitro-1H-indazol-1-yl)propan-2-ol
In the title compound, C10H10ClN3O3, the side chain is oriented nearly perpendicular to the mean plane of the indazole ring system. In the crystal, complementary sets of O—H...N and C—H...O hydrogen bonds form chains of molecules stacked along the a-axis

Novel extremophilic tryptophanases (TnaAs) are tested in the synthesis of L‐tryptophan analogues. This study compares a thermophilic and a halophilic TnaA with E. coli TnaA as benchmark, from both structural and catalytic perspectives, revealing enhanced stability, and a broader substrate scope for the new homologues.
